Call for Artists in Central Florida


Exciting news from Orlando Fringe! 

This year Visual Fringe will have its own space in a 13,000 sq ft warehouse on Alden Rd. (near the Fringe office). 

In addition to the usual space at Orlando Shakes, festivities will include a weekend art market, artist-designed indoor putt-putt course, live music, food trucks and more!

Artists who are interested in the putt-putt, installation or street art can contact NecolePynn@gmail.com
